filter
let r= [],
arr = ['apple', 'strawberry','pear'];
r = arr.filter(function (element, index, self) {
return self.indexOf(element) === index;
});
console.log(r.toString());
set 、array
Array.from(new Set(array));
let resultarr = [...new Set(arr)];
拷贝
- 数组拷贝
this.nodeNameList = [];
for (let k in this.checkList1) {
this.nodeNameList = [...this.nodeNameList, ...this.checkList1[k].nodeNames];
}
- 对象拷贝
this.entity={...this.entity}